1917 is a movie chalk-full of impressive visuals and fantastic direction. The entire film crew should be commended for the work put into this movie. I have nothing but good things to say in my 1917 review.

IMDB Synopsis:
April 6th 1917. As a regiment assembles to wage war deep in enemy territory, two soldiers are assigned to race against time and deliver a message, that will stop 1,600 men, from walking straight into a deadly trap.
